The Air Purifier market is a subset of the Household Appliances industry. It is composed of products designed to improve the air quality in a home or other indoor space. Air purifiers typically use a combination of filters, fans, and other technologies to remove airborne particles, such as dust, pollen, smoke, and other allergens. They can also reduce odors and other pollutants, such as volatile organic compounds (VOCs). Air purifiers are becoming increasingly popular as people become more aware of the health benefits of clean air.
Air purifiers come in a variety of sizes and styles, ranging from small, portable units to larger, more powerful models. They can be powered by electricity, batteries, or even solar energy. Many air purifiers also feature additional features, such as air quality sensors, timers, and remote control.
Some of the leading companies in the Air Purifier market include Honeywell, Dyson, Philips, Sharp, and Coway. Show Less Read more
